On Thursday, Rep. Ilhan Omar (D-Minn.) tweeted that President Donald Trump is “deranged, bizarre, incoherent, and sad.” Omar said this after Trump referred to himself as a “stable genius.”
There is nothing “stable” or “genius” about these public rants from a president.
Deranged, bizarre, incoherent, sad … come to mind. https://t.co/lIvBisqGvQ
— Ilhan Omar (@IlhanMN) May 24, 2019
Omar’s remarks are in response to Trump’s press conference regarding a $16 billion aid package for farmers. During the press conference, Trump slammed Speaker Nancy Pelosi (D-Calif.) and Senate Minority Leader Chuck Schumer (D-N.Y.) for claiming he was not serious about bipartisan support for infrastructure, and that he had a “temper tantrum.”
Trump maintains that he was calm during the meeting with Schumer and Pelosi.
This is not the first time the freshman member has made remarks about Trump. In March she suggested that he is “sub-human” in comparison to former President Barack Obama. Even after the Mueller report found no collusion or obstruction, Omar is calling for impeachment proceedings to begin.
